We can expect a few more days of really hot temperatures, with a heat warning still in effect for the North Bay area.

While we were close to temperature records last Friday and on Sunday, we haven’t set any new records yet.

But that could change.

The forecast is calling for a high of 31 today, which is close to a record (31.7 set in 1966).

The high tomorrow is expected to be 34.

That would surpass the 1944 record of 29.4 degrees.
